PC - The Dredge cannot look left or right if stunned while using his power

Detailed Description:

If The Dredge is stunned at the same time they attempt to use their power to teleport to lockers, their camera wil be locked in such a way that prevents them to look to their left or right. They can still look up or down.

If The Dredge teleports to a locker, they can move their camera left and right for as long as they are inside it, but the camera will become locked again upon exiting.

The camera controls remain locked indefinitely, but can be reestablished if a survivor allows The Dredge to successfully hit them with his weapon.

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Load into a game as The Dredge.
  2. While chasing a survivor, activate The Gloaming.
  3. While The Gloaming is active, attempt to teleport to a locker when you're near a pallet.
  4. At the same time you attempt to activate The Gloaming, have a survivor stun you with said pallet.
  5. Observe the results.

Expected results:

Either The Dredge is stunned by the pallet, or they successfully teleport. In either case, the camera controls should not be horizontally locked.

Actual results:

The Dredge will not teleport. Additionally, the camera controls will become locked horizontally, meaning The Dredge cannot look to their left or right anymore by moving their camera, but only if they are outside a locker. If they teleport into a locker, they will be able to move their camera left and right, but will subsequently lose this camera control as soon as they exit the locker. The camera remains horizontally locked until a survivor is hit with a basic attack from The Dredge.

Frequency:

Only observed once so far, but this is because the conditions for this bug to manifest have only presented once to this player.

Additional information:

Considering how this bug is triggered, this might also happen to killers that can teleport by phasing through terrain in a predetermined path, if they attempt to use their powers in similar circumstances. Might not happen to killers that teleport instantly, such as The Nightmare or The Onryō.
